Please understand that an MPEG-2 for DVD file is several times smaller than the original DV .avi file - the extra compression discards a lot of data. That doesn't mean the DVD needs to look bad necessarily - compression settings can have a lot to do with that, as well as which encoder you're using, as some produce better results than others.

How are you encoding the footage - what is the source, and what are the compression settings?
